Five hundred construction workers were turned away from the construction site of the natural gas-powered Carty Generating Station in Oregon, reports the East Oregonian. The OREGON BUSINESS EXPANSION AND RETENTION PROGRAM is a new tool that creates a state incentive available to existing companies expanding operations in Oregon or new companies coming in to the state.
